On March 4, U.S. Border Patrol agents of the Presidio Station apprehended around 60 undocumented non-citizens near Presidio. The group consisted of single adults and family units from Cuba. The subjects were transported to the station for processing.

Marathon ISD students recently participated in the Big Bend Regional History Fair held in Alpine, and will now be advancing to the state finals in Austin. Sponsors were teachers John Newton and Joy Golden. Proudly showing off their medals of achievement are Sadie Carter, Jackson Barlow, Caylee Hernandez, Alysa Garcia, Annaliese West, Madeline West, Marissa Guerrero, Izabella Briones, Elah Barlow, Melodi Aguilar, and Campbell West.

Press those neat western jeans, pull on your cowboy boots, and shine up those belt buckles because it’s time to go two-stepping. Both avid dancers or those with two left feet will find a place on Friday, March 18 at 7 pm at the Kelly Pavilion in Fort Davis for the inaugural Family Barn Dance, featuring live music by Doug Moreland.
